Quote:
Originally Posted by 124
I thought I might add that in the Vlsd the V stands for viscous. Viscous diffs are basically a single open diff with some friction plates that heat up a fluid which then engages the other half but only if it gets hot enough. This system works well if used for an extended period of time or if warmed up before use (eg small burnout) but generally, when driving around normally it wont do anything if you try to drift straight up. So it is a cheap alternative to a proper lsd but its like anything you get what you pay for.
Your mistaken I'm afraid.

They don't have that effect, in fact the opposite effect. Go and jack up a VLSD equipped car and you will struggle to turn the wheel on its own.

If someone was to pratt around trying to drift all day then the viscous unit warms up. Its an energy absorber. Once its hot a worn unit won't have much resistance anymore. Just like butter.

Its a damn good modification. Its not geared towards drifting. If you want drift then spend £700 on a Nismo GT pro diff.
